Output 76ab08d39363811ed6a309859afe521f85fc15b38c51b01300bd24dfdc653230:1

value
30369327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a63d2e0eaf2cd443aeb776ae6e4ca61923f61e OP_EQUAL
address
368FWEoJQ16jcXQ9iG7uJ8k5azLMc6daQP
transaction
76ab08d39363811ed6a309859afe521f85fc15b38c51b01300bd24dfdc653230
spent
true